Marble Sort Level 517 is a tricky puzzle that looks easy but hides a wall of Mystery Boxes behind a tempting front row. The key to victory is to focus on clearing Green first to unlock the left side, while deliberately avoiding the Yellow, Purple, and extra Light Blue boxes that are pure bait.
The board is split: the Top Tray has a front line of Light Blue, Blue, Red, Green, Yellow, Light Blue, and Purple, with three rows of Mystery Boxes behind them. Two yellow bars lock the upper half—the left bar tied to a Green ring, the right to an Orange ring. On the sides are blue and red Gift Boxes with a '3' timer. The bottom Boxes demand, from left to right: Orange, Red, Blue, Green.
Marble Sort Level 517 Walkthrough
Your immediate task is to match the bottom demands. Start by clearing the Red, Blue, and Green from the front row into their matching bottom slots. The leftmost Light Blue is a decoy—do not touch it. The Yellow and Purple are also traps. You must find an Orange to fill the bottom-left, but it's hidden behind the Mystery Boxes.
The critical imbalance: you have easy access to Red, Blue, and Green, but Orange is locked away. If you start dumping random colors to find it, your belt will jam. Instead, deliberately drop the leftmost Light Blue to expose a Mystery Box, and carefully tap it hoping for Orange. If you get a wrong color, park it on the belt and try the next one, but you have limited space, so you must ignore the bait colors to save room.
How to Beat Marble Sort Level 517 — Step-by-Step
Phase one: Secure the bottom row
- Tap the Blue box from the front row and drop it into the Blue slot on the bottom.
- Next, tap the Red box and guide it to the Red slot.
- Then tap the Green box and release it into the Green slot, which also triggers the left lock to open.
- Now, tap the leftmost Light Blue box to send it to the belt, exposing the first Mystery Box.
- Tap that Mystery Box. If it's Orange, drop it into the bottom-left slot. If not, let it sit on the belt and tap the next Mystery Box behind it, repeating until you find Orange.
Phase two: Pop the Gift Boxes and break the right lock
- Once the entire bottom row (Orange, Red, Blue, Green) is cleared, the bottom row shifts, and new demands appear, including Light Blue and Blue.
- Because you cleared the edges, the side Gift Boxes burst open, dumping new boxes onto the board.
- Search the newly exposed boxes or dig into right-side Mystery Boxes to find an Orange box.
- When you have Orange and a bottom slot asks for it, drop it immediately to shatter the right yellow bar.
- Now, flush any Light Blue or leftover boxes off your belt if the bottom demands them—never hold a color that a bottom slot is asking for.
Phase three: Clear the back row methodically
- With both locks broken, the top back row is exposed: White, Orange, Brown, Pink, and Yellow.
- Do not drop these randomly. Only release Pink and Yellow when the bottom slots explicitly request them, as the bottom stacks have deep Orange and Green needs near the end.
- Keep White and Brown in the Top Tray until their matching slots appear.
- Use your belt strictly for temporary storage, and you'll finish with ease.
Tips & tricks
- Always clear the front-row Blue, Red, and Green first—they are safe and unlock the left lock via Green.
- Never send Yellow, Purple, or the extra Light Blue to the belt early; they'll clog it and block your search for Orange.
- When fishing for Orange, tap Mystery Boxes one at a time and park wrong colors on the belt only if you have room; otherwise, wait for a bottom slot to accept them.
- After the first row clears, the Gift Boxes will pop—use their contents to find Orange for the right lock.
- Keep the top back row (White, Brown, etc.) untouched until the bottom demands them.
Common mistakes
- Dropping the Yellow or Purple bait early, which fills the belt and leaves no room for the Mystery Box pulls.
- Failing to prioritize Green, which stalls the left lock and blocks access to needed Mystery Boxes.
- Holding onto a color that the bottom is asking for, causing a delay and potential belt jam.
- Randomly clearing the back row without checking bottom demands, leading to mismatched colors and a stuck board.
